Points Betting in Basketball In sports betting, once the oddsmaker determines the point spread number of points the favorite among the two teams will win , the bettor can bet on the choice to win by more units or the Underdog to lose by fewer points.
For example, if the sports betting site has the Chicago Bulls as a 3-point favorite -3 against the Brooklyn Nets, with NBA games points betting, you could choose to bet on the Bulls to win by more than 3 points or the Nets would be the losing team by 3 points. Likewise, if the final score were Nets , Bulls , your bet on the Nets would be a winner.
You can also bet on the favorite to cover the point spread or the Underdog to cover their point spread bet. In our example, if you bet on the Chicago Bulls to cover the spread, they would need to win the game by 4 or more points. On the other hand, if you bet on the Brooklyn Nets to cover the spread, they could lose by 2 or fewer points or win the game outright. Points Betting with Football A point spread wager in football involves the same concepts as point spread betting on any other two teams anywhere.
Here is an example of how point spreads work in a football game. This means that the Chiefs are favored to win by three points, or the Dolphins are predicted to lose by three points. If you bet on the Kansas City Chiefs, they would need a winning margin of 4 or more points for you to win your bet. However, if you bet on the Dolphins, they could lose by 2 or less points or win the game outright, and you would still win your bet.
